The Audit Director is a senior level management position responsible for contributing to the strategic direction of Citi's Internal Audit (IA) function, in coordination with the Audit team. This role is also responsible for managing multiple teams of professionals. The overall objective of this role is to direct audit activities that support a subset of a product line, function, or legal entity at the global or regional level, in accordance with IA standards, Citi policies, and local regulations.

This role will contribute to the scoping and execution of AML audit coverage in accordance with established IA methodology and professional auditing standards, legal entity governance reporting, and other regulatory compliance audits. The position will be based in Singapore and will report directly into the Chief Auditor AML International, with matrix reporting line to the Regional Chief Auditor for APAC.The position will provide IA's APAC AML International team with leadership and direction to ensure the provision of independent assurance which is consistent and aligned with the Global IA strategies and APAC business objectives.
The candidate should have strong functional knowledge of regional and local regulatory AML and Sanctions programs that have been established to comply with the regulatory requirements, Citi policies and procedures, provisions and guidelines established by the various key APAC regulators, OCC, Federal Reserve, and all applicable regulations governing local banking activites and operations.The candidate must have extensive working knowledge of regulatory requirements and the related risks and controls and demonstrate the ability to work with senior management and lead audit team execution.
